Who we're looking for:
Asia-Pacific Latin-America (APLA) is a multi-cultural, growth Geography looking for a Data Engineer Manager who can partner with a variety of Nike teams to build and support analytical data products that drive Nike's consumer experience.
The successful candidate will bring their proven leadership experience, their excellent communication and relationship building skills in addition to their current, hands-on coding skills. In this role, you will be responsible for coaching developers to continuously elevate their engineering skills and to deliver innovative and high-quality solutions. You'll lead by example, promote our agile culture, and be an advocate of new technology and development techniques!
What you'll work on:
- Facilitate team's delivery of scalable, maintainable, performant data engineering solutions
- Work through your teams to define/design solution options, evaluate technical feasibility, and provide estimates on effort and risk
- Drive the design and implementation of new data projects and the optimization of existing solutions
- Collaborate across teams - business partners, product, engineering, architecture, platforms - to facilitate solution delivery
- Work with architecture and engineers to ensure quality solutions are implemented, and engineering practices are defined and followed
- Drive collaborative reviews of designs, code, and test plans
- Define the team's technical roadmap and influence its adoption
- Anticipate, identify and solve issues concerning data management to improve data quality
- Work across teams to resolve operational & performance issues
- Identify and remove technical bottlenecks for your engineering teams
- Manage, mentor, and inspire the team; manage performance, goals and development potential
- Provide guidance to team members on work items or technical scenarios
- Evaluate potential new engineering talent
This role is part of APLA Technology's Enterprise Data & Analytics organization. You will lead teams of data engineers, software engineers, data analysts and collaborate with other leaders and business partners within APLA and across the company. Nike moves quickly, which requires its business processes and systems to follow suit. The Data Engineering Manager is responsible for leading the team through these evolutions to ensure technical solutions keep pace.
What you bring:
The following qualifications and technical skills will position you well for this role:
- MS/BS in Computer Science, Information Systems, Business, or related field, or equivalent combination of education and experience and training
- 7+ years of experience in large-scale software development, 3+ years of data engineering experience
- 2+ years of management or team lead experience
- Proven track record of delivering on commitments
- Ability to define/design solution options, evaluate technical feasibility, and provide estimates on effort and risk
- Ability to lead, influence and communicate effectively, both verbally and written, across teams and roles
- Solid foundation in data structures, algorithms and architecture patterns
- Experience building distributed / cloud scalable, high-performance data solutions
- Demonstrated competence in Python and Apache Spark
- Experience with messaging/streaming/complex event processing tooling and frameworks with an emphasis on Spark Structured Streaming or Apache Nifi
- Experience with data warehousing concepts, SQL and SQL Analytical functions
- Ability to learn new technologies, adapt quickly, and lead a team of highly capable engineers
- Experience participating in key business, architectural and technical decisions
- Experience identifying, hiring, and nurturing/mentoring engineering talent
- Ability to identify and resolve both people and process related issues
- Experience in Agile/Scrum application development
- Familiarity with the principles of Domain Driven Design
- Comfort with a fast-paced, results-oriented environment
- Practical approach to solving complex problems with ambiguous requirements
The following skills and experience are also relevant to our overall environment, and nice to have:
- Experience programming in Scala, or Java
- Experience working in a public cloud environment, particularly AWS
- Experience with cloud warehouse tools like Snowflake
- Experience working with NoSQL data stores such as HBase, DynamoDB, etc.
- Experience building RESTful API's to enable data consumption
- Experience with build tools such as Terraform or CloudFormation and automation tools such as Jenkins
- Experience with practices like Continuous Development, Continuous Integration and Automated Testing
